Develop
2017.04.14 10:38
[ios] NSString, RegularExpression Find/Replace
조회 수 846 댓글 0
정규표현식으로 문자열 교체하는 예제
예) Kakao 계정에서 닉네임에 이모티콘 있을 시 제거하는 내용
NSString *pattern = @"[^\uAC00-\uD7A3xfe0-9a-zA-Z\\s]"; NSString *kakaoNickname = @"123 &1245; Hooni Test!!^^"; NSError *error = nil; NSRegularExpression *regex = [NSRegularExpression regularExpressionWithPattern:pattern options:NSRegularExpressionCaseInsensitive error:&error]; NSString *modifiedString = [regex stringByReplacingMatchesInString:kakaoNickname options:0 range:NSMakeRange(0, [kakaoNickname length]) withTemplate:@""]; NSLog(@"kakaoNickname : %@", modifiedString);
TAG •
-
[mysql] ERROR 1820 (HY000): You must reset your password using ALTER USER statement before executing this statement.
-
[js] 문자열에서 숫자만 걸러내기 (jQuery 안쓰고 정규표현식)
-
[js] URL 파싱하기 (jQuery 안쓰고)
-
[linux] 초간단 SquirrelMail 설치/설정 (다람쥐 메일)
-
[linux] 초간단 Postfix, Covecot, SSL/TLS (SMTP)
-
[php] Laravel 5.4: Specified key was too long error
-
[php] mysql_ 과 mysqli_ 의 차이
-
[mysql] MySQL 한글 깨짐 현상 해결하기(UTF8)
-
RSVP 란?
-
[mysql] 중복데이터 삭제하는 초간단 쿼리
-
[mac] How to uninstall MySQL on Mac OS.
-
OpenSSL로 ROOT CA 생성 및 SSL 인증서 발급하기